In this video, I'll guide you through multiple steps to create a CSV file from Excel. You'll learn about using save as a command, preserving special characters, applying UTF-16 encoding, using Google Sheets, and applying VBA code. A CSV file can be used to create simple databases, archive and back up data, and facilitate data analysis. With practical examples and step-by-step instructions, you can effortlessly make a CSV file in your own Excel spreadsheets.
